I'd like to talk about my presentation in the following three aspects. The first is to strengthen the capability of innovation and make masterpiece Olympic construction.

I think that you have gathered a lot of information related to the Olympic constructions. Here I just would like to give the highlights. During the construction, there are three points which focused on the structures, the safety and security issues and the 'Green Olympics' which is the energy conservation Olympics.

All of these steels used in the venues such as the National Stadium (Bird's Nest), the National Swimming Center (Water Cube) and stadiums at Beijing University of Technology (Olympic Badminton) and Peking University (Olympic Table Tennis) amount to 150, 000 tons. So in the construction of these venues, because of the complicated structures, and the feature of large structure, it is very difficult to tackle. So we have used the innovative method to design, make, and test these venues.

We have also formed the whole package of testing, manufacturing and implementing the whole steel structure, because we all know that the safety and security issue of steel structure is very important. I can see that all of these Olympic venues are earthquake resistant and thundering resistance.

Furthermore, I would like to talk about quality of steels used in these Olympic venues. Actually, in the past, we only used some machines to strengthen our steels and this time, we depend on our own technology to research on the strength and resilience skills to be used on Olympic venues.

For the second aspect, I would like to talk about the green energy usage in the construction. First, the use of energy, special use of new and clean and renewable energy. And the new material, we also adopted this new energy saving building materials. Even for the bricks, we also take water absorbing capability of the bricks into consideration. We have made a lot of efforts on the green energy, energy saving and green material.

I would like to release a news that is related to energy saving. After ten days, until the Paralympics, in the Olympic common domain, we all use the energy saving and use of hydrogen and electrical cars. That is, ten days later, the transportation of all the vehicles in the Olympic common domain will realize the goal of zero emission. At this moment the vehicles handover ceremony is now in processing.

It's for the new standards and for the patterns that I would like to give a general idea. First of all, the patterns need to be verified. For example, in the steel structures like Mr .Yang has just briefed that there are some highlights. All together, there are 5 effects leading the world onstage and more than 15 technologies leading domestically and reached the advanced level internationally.

For patterns as I have just mentioned, they need to be verified and the verification needs a standard process. As far as I know, for the Olympic projects, because they are just ready for the delivery, my general idea is that this year the patterns have entered the verification processes and have been approved to reach 30 to 50.

For new standards, during the Olympic construction, we have got a lot of new technology and evolved into new standards. According to incomplete statistics, there are altogether 40 new standards have been created. In the future, these new standards can evolve into local standards and the national standards.

NO. 3 is the level of the mobilization of social resources, and how to integrate all these resources and to be used in the construction. I think that incorporating these levels of management skills into a high efficient management system of the construction is a feature for the Olympic projects.

For example, in the steel project, it is coordinated by the government and participated by research institutes, steel enterprises and different stuffs who worked in the designs. In management level, we collect the wisdom of all these talents in the process such as the researching of new process and new standards designing and making in the final stage of the construction of the Bird's Nest and even the unloading. I think this is a typical example to link all the social resources together to make a complicated project.

August in Beijing, the weather is quite temperate. The weather features high temperate and high humility. For plants, it's difficult for flowers to get blossomed.

During the Olympic time, we need to use a lot of flowers to beautify the environment and it also contributes to the city environment.

And for our feasibility studies after research and development, we have chosen 2,000 types of flowers which will blossom in August. From these 2000 types of flowers, we have chosen 800 flowers which do not need to be watered too much. And finally, we have chosen 560 flowers as the Olympic flowers. More than 20 types of such flowers are used in the Olympic common domain. So we can see that now and in August, Beijing will become the world of flowers.

Guided by the three principles and concepts of 'Green Olympics, High-tech Olympics and People's Olympics,' we have created a lot of scientific research in the construction of Olympics projects.

We have made some meaningful examples in the use of new energy and energy saving. For example, in terms of solar photovoltaic power generation, we have incorporated these projects with the construction venues and landscapes. For the photo-thermo technology, it is more widely used, for example, in the Olympic Village during the Games-time, the hot water in the rooms is provided by the photo-thermo technology.

We have also used different types of heat pumps technology. All of these projects give examples in the similar future projects on how to save energy and reduce the impact on the environment.

Second, in the utilization of the water resource, we have done our research and made some good examples.

We all probably know that there is a lake in the Olympic Green. How to maintain the quality of the water in the lake is also highlighted in the Olympic projects.

For the lake, we have used the wetland that belongs to the bio purification technologies and also we have used some artificial purification technologies in the future to maintain good quality of water in the lake. This has also set an example for future projects.

We have also take active roles in the research and the exploration of using the rainfall water especially in Beijing and other cities in China. These cities are all greatly short of water.

And also in the public areas of the projects and the residential areas such as the Olympic Village and Media Village, we have all implemented Beijing standard of energy efficiency. These standards are higher and more stringent than the national standard.
